Horizon Zero Dawn – Blazing Sun Marks Guide (All Trials at Hunting Grounds)

February 10, 2017 by PowerPyx 1 Comment

In Horizon Zero Dawn you can play Hunting Ground Trials to earn Blazing Sun Marks (highscore) or Half Sun Marks (mediocre score). These are little challenges to test your skills. Each hunting ground has 3 different trial challenges. They are scattered across 5 hunting ground locations for a total of 15 trials.

There are four trophies tied to Hunting Ground Trials, including the only gold trophy in the game for getting a blazing sun mark in all of them:

  • Bronze – Earned at least a Half Sun mark in all three trials at one hunting ground
  • Bronze – Earned a Blazing Sun mark in all three trials at one hunting ground
  • Silver – Earned at least a half sun mark in all trials at all hunting grounds
  • Gold – Earned a blazing sun mark in all trials at all hunting grounds

 

Blazing Sun Marks Walkthrough:

This video walkthrough shows all of them with a blazing sun mark. They are marked by a blue icon on the map after climbing the Tallnecks.
I recommend you get the Shield-Weaver outfit first because it renders you invincible and makes some challenges easier: How to get Secret Shield Weaver Outfit
Buy as many purple weapons as you can, especially the Shadow Hunter Bow and Shadow Sharpshot Bow. If you have trouble with a trial wait until the end of the game when you are level 30 or higher. At this point it will be very easy.

All of these challenges are time based. The faster you are, the better you will score. The blazing sun marks are basically gold medals. It also gives you 17,500 XP per blazing sun mark which is great for quick level ups.
For the trial “Ravager Control” you must learn how to override ravagers with your spear. You get this ability by completing Cauldron RHO (Cauldrons are also marked on the map with blue icons).

After getting all blazing sun marks you can trade them in at the Hunter’s Lodge in Meridian. A woman named Aidaba will give you 3 blessed weapons, which are the best in the entire game and cannot be bought from other merchants. So you do get an actual reward aside from the trophy.
